Coyote Hills Hike(3.12mi,300 ft elevation gain)


Details
Coyote Hills Regional Park is located in Fremont. Coyote Hills offers 360-deree views of the Bay. On clear days, Oakland and San Francisco skylines are visible as well as Mt. Tamalpais and the Santa Cruz Mountains. We will also enjoy spectacular views of the East Bay Hills, the marshlands and the Dumbarton Bridge.

Please meet at the Visitor Center’s parking lot. The trail offers no shade. Make sure to use sunblock and wear a hat. There are some moderate climbs and descends, but they are short.
Bring plenty of water and snacks.
Driving Directions:
From CA 84 in Fremont exit Paseo Padre Parkway/Thornton Avenue and go north. Turn left onto Patterson Ranch Road. Pay the parking fee and drive to the end of the road near the Visitor Center.
